Will Zeekr 001 Disappear in 2026? Company Responds to Viral Replacement Rumor

In recent weeks, the automotive world has been abuzz with rumors suggesting that Zeekr's flagship model, the 001, might be replaced by a new model under a different name in 2026. These speculations, which quickly spread across Chinese social media and auto forums, have prompted the company to issue an official response. On October 15, Zeekr addressed the rumors directly, confirming that there are no plans to replace or rename the 001 model in the foreseeable future.

The rumors began gaining traction thanks to discussions among Zeekr owners and electric vehicle (EV) enthusiasts online. Many speculated that a new model would take over the 001's position as Zeekr's flagship EV. However, the company's official statement, released as part of their "Zeekr 001 Q&A (Part 3)" update, refutes these claims. Zeekr emphasized that the recently refreshed 001, which debuted on October 11, will remain a cornerstone of their lineup for an extended period.

The updated Zeekr 001 offers significant advancements, including improvements in its powertrain, chassis, safety features, driver assistance, and intelligent cabin systems. It retains its distinctive shooting brake design, maximizing interior space. These updates align with Zeekr's strategy to continue refining the 001 series, ensuring it remains competitive in the luxury electric vehicle segment. The company also highlighted that any future changes would be introduced through over-the-air software updates or optional equipment modifications, adapting to user needs and market trends.

Introduced in 2021 as Zeekr's inaugural model, the 001 has made a substantial impact globally, with deliveries surpassing 300,000 units across more than 40 countries and regions. The 2026 lineup is built on a 900V high-voltage platform, offering up to 810 km of range according to the CLTC standard. The dual-motor variant produces a formidable 925 horsepower, achieving 0–100 km/h in just 2.83 seconds, with a top speed of 280 km/h. Each model is equipped with lidar, Nvidia's Thor-U chip, and Zeekr's H7 driver assistance suite, illustrating the company's commitment to high-performance and safety.

Zeekr's decision to maintain the 001 as its flagship model reflects its confidence in the vehicle's design and market appeal. The car's price in China starts at 269,800 yuan (approximately 37,000 USD) for the 95 kWh dual-motor Max version, reaching 329,800 yuan (around 45,200 USD) for the 103 kWh Ultra+ trim. These price points position the 001 competitively within the luxury EV market, offering advanced technology and impressive performance. The company's strategic focus on the 001 suggests a long-term vision centered around this model as a key player in their portfolio.

As the automotive industry continues to evolve, Zeekr's commitment to the 001 demonstrates a strategic approach to maintaining its presence in the luxury EV sector. By leveraging advanced technology and continuous updates, Zeekr aims to keep the 001 at the forefront of innovation and appeal. While rumors of model replacements may arise, the company's clear communication and ongoing enhancements ensure that the 001 remains a pivotal element of its strategy, reassuring both current owners and potential buyers of its longevity and relevance.
